do you lose hair on the sides of your head ? if yes it is possibly some other medical condition like thyroid or you might be missing vitamins or sth .
if hairloss is only on the top of your head it might be the start of diffuse thinning , but it is hard to see from the pics .
your best shot is to visit a derm specialized in hairloss
also get your bloodwork done to see if anything is off
